Lip Balm Obsessed: A Review Part II

I purchased this because I was disappointed in the Original Burt's Bees Lip Balm (see that review here.) I looked at the wide variety of kinds (original, revitalizing, nourishing, refreshing, hydrating, rejuvenating,replenishing,soothing...)

Burt's Bees
Revitalizing
Beeswax Lip Balm
With Blueberry & Dark Chocolate
100% Natural
$2.97 at Walmart


The OPTIONS. So many.... I chose revitalizing because it said "a decadent and 100% natural combination for lips that feel soft and renewed."

Since SOFT is what I wanted, I thought this was best.

Boy, did I chose right! I really want to buy every single one though honestly.

I like the smell a lot. I'm a huge fan of both chocolate and blueberries. I'm not the hugest fan of them together but the chocolate is definitely second fiddle to the sweet blueberry smell that wafts off my lips.

I will say that the chocolate smell isn't as strong as the blueberry and that in my opinion is a good thing because the chocolate is that weird.. artificial chocolate smell. Like when you scratch n' sniff a chocolate sticker. It doesn't smell like chocolate. It smells like weird cardboard sweet nutella or something.

It is very smooth, smells nice, and makes my lips soft. Perfection. Now if only I could get this in like.. coconut or raspberry.. yum. That would be EVEN better.
